State Papers: Donation to Garda fund after release of kidnapped Dutch industrialist 'far too large'

Tiede Herrema showing the bullet given to him by Eddie Gallagher just before his release in November 1975.
Civil servants in Ireland expressed concern that the offer of a IR£5,000 contribution to the Garda Benevolent Fund from the government of the Netherlands following the successful release in 1975 of kidnapped Dutch industrialist, Tiede Herrema, was “far too large.”
Newly-released State papers show the Department of Foreign Affairs were monitoring both diplomatic and media coverage of the kidnapping of Dr Herrema by the IRA because of its potential impact on foreign direct investment in Ireland.
